Transaction ed4e4e17637c953dfebe01ed80a2edf0dee6c3146478a02c5ae422016430b010

1 Input
2 Outputs
  • ed4e4e17637c953dfebe01ed80a2edf0dee6c3146478a02c5ae422016430b010:0
  • value  119941042
    address  12Hv67tfzYDNjVT4phTChnGNdzB33mQGmS
  • ed4e4e17637c953dfebe01ed80a2edf0dee6c3146478a02c5ae422016430b010:1
  • value  22540000
    address  3PDAMY2Rx5fTYxZkMVdT1RSfEXJvAQrRZD